Bahamas News Fifty-Six Students at Columbus Primary Commissioned into Queen Mary’s Bahamas Clothing Guild Published 8 years ago on June 11, 2018 By Deandrea Hamilton #Nassau, June 11, 2018 – Bahamas – Governor General Her Excellency Dame Marguerite Pindling attended the Commissioning Service of 56 students into the Queen Mary’s Bahamas Clothing Guild at Columbus Primary School on Tuesday, June 5, 2018.
